Here's our experience from yesterday, Sunday 1/26. It's a little long, I'm sorry.

Parked around 5:55, through bag check and in line about 6:08, through tapstiles around 6:30. We found a place to sit right by HBD and waited. It was cold.

All five of us have the app and own accounts with everybody linked. As there have been a few strategies suggested on this thread, we each took a different approach. Amongst us we have Apple XS, Galaxy S10, Pixel 3XL, and 2 Samsung JV's. Half we're on Wi-Fi, half we're on data with Verizon, 2 had the app open and refreshing or clicking back and forth by 6:58. I opened the app when I heard the chime and the other 2 opened when it hit 7:00.

We got BG 102 at 7:01 using AppleXS on data and refresh method. (I think we didn't get an earlier BG due to my family being nervous and unsure of what to do initially. We have 4 more days and will try again. Anyway...)

We were in a backup boarding group. But I wasn't worried, as the day before the backup BG's started at 99 and BG 151 had been called (thanks The Chart!!!). We went off and enjoyed our day, built some droids, lightsabers, taunted a few Stormtroopers, hacked some terminals, had some libations and rode MF:SR 3 times.

We monitored the progression of the BG's and noticed the stalling throughout the day. We talked to a CM at RotR around 4 when the ride was stalled in the 60's, she said that our BG was still scheduled to be called.

Fast forward to 6:15pm and we had to head to Launch Bay for our DP reservation and our BG hadn't been called yet, but they were on 100 at that point. As we were leaving TSL at 6:22 our BG, 102, was called. We had a return window of 1 hour and had to be tapped in by 7:22.

I immediately went to the GET right outside TSL/Municiberg. At GET I calmly explained that our backup BG had just been called, but unfortunately we did have a prepaid DP reservation and asked if we could please get recovery passes (term CM from earlier had used). She asked how many more days we had left, 3 I told her. We didn't need 1 day tickets, and just we're requesting recovery passes for sometime in the next 4 days. We were all calm and jovial and she was happy to help.

Here's where I'm a little worried.
She scanned my MB, and then had me fill out a carbon form with all my information, and then she gave me a piece of HS GET notepaper with my name, show id, 5 anytime passes to RotR written on it. She said that she didn't have the capability at her station to enter the information, they would do it later when at a proper terminal. We were to bring that paper back to GS tomorrow and they could give us/link our passes. Has anyone else experienced this? I'm a little worried.

Even with not being able to ride RotR we had an amazing day. That being said we will try at least 2 more times on out trip.
